The Boss – Bixby ore deposit is one of several iron deposits associated with the Precambrian igneouus rocks of then St. Francois mountains of southeastern Missouri. Boss – Bixby was discovered in 1956 by drilling a blind magnetic anomoly under Paleozoic cover. The deposit, located about 3 miles west of the Magmont lead-zinc mine on the Viburnum Trend, was never developed and is known only from drilling.

The Boss – Bixby ore deposit is localized near the margin of a ring-like syenite intrusion known as the Boss Plutonic complex. Ore minerals are disseminated in the syenite, in adjacent rhyolites and in associated fractures and breccias. Boss – Bixby is different than other iron deposits in the region in being rich in titanium, containing very little apatite (or rare earth elements), and including a large amount of copper. The copper-rich portions of the ore deposit occur as lenses within the iron ore. Day, et al (2001) give the copper ore reserve as approximately 40 mt at 0.8%. Covers Dent and Iron Counties.

References

Sort by

Year (asc) Year (desc) Author (A-Z) Author (Z-A)
Day, W.C., Seeger, C.M., and Rye, R.O., 2001, Review of the iron oxide deposits of Missouriβ€”Magmatic end members of the iron oxide-Cu-Au-U-REE deposit family [abs]: Geological Society of America Abstracts with Programs, v. 33, no. 6, p. 4
Shelton, K.L., Burstein, I.B., Hagni, R.D., Vierrether, C.B., Grant, S.K., Hennigh, Q.T., Bradley, M.F., and Brandom, R.T. (1995) Sulfur isotope evidence for penetration of MVT fluids into igneous basement rocks, southeast Missouri, USA. Mineralium Deposita 30, 339-350.
Smith, F.J., 1968, Mineralization of the Boss Bixby Anomaly, Iron and Dent Counties, Missouri, Masters Theses: Univ. of Missouri at Rolla.
